Understanding Reward Types: Cashback, Points, and Miles

When it comes to credit card rewards, options abound, and choosing the right type for your lifestyle can be as crucial as picking the right streaming service (or maybe even more so). Broadly speaking, rewards come in three varieties:

  • Cashback: Perfect if you like the idea of money in your pocket. Cashback cards offer a percentage of your spending back as real cash. Think of it as turning your everyday purchases into an extra paycheck. With categories ranging from groceries to dining out, these cards reward you for living your life—no fine print required.
  • Points: These versatile rewards can be redeemed for anything from travel to merchandise. Points-based cards often come with partnerships that let you transfer your points to airline and hotel loyalty programs. If you’re the type to like options, accumulating points might just be your secret weapon.
  • Miles: If your heart beats for globetrotting, miles cards are your passport to adventure. Every dollar spent equals travel miles, bringing you closer to that dream trip abroad. They often come with exclusive travel perks like lounge access and hotel credits, making them a hit among jet-setters.

While some cards offer one type of reward exclusively, others provide a hybrid approach, enabling you to earn a combination of rewards. In 2025, we’re seeing a surge in customizable rewards programs that let you tailor benefits to your unique spending habits—because why settle for less when you can have it all?

Strategies to Maximize Your Credit Card Rewards

Let’s cut to the chase—having a killer rewards credit card is only half the battle. Knowing how to wield it like a pro is where you turn everyday spending into a rewards bonanza. Here are some winning strategies that will help you supercharge your rewards:

Know Your Spending Habits

Before picking a rewards card, assess where your money goes. Are you a serial foodie always on the hunt for trendy brunch spots? Or maybe you’re a globetrotter with regular airline expenses. Tailoring your card choice to your spending patterns maximizes your rewards potential. Use budgeting apps and transaction tracking tools to understand spending trends and adjust your card usage accordingly.

Capitalize on Bonus Categories

Many credit cards feature rotating bonus categories that offer extra rewards for purchases—be it on dining, groceries, or even streaming services. Make sure you know when these categories kick in, and plan your spending to take full advantage. Set reminders or subscribe to email alerts from your credit card issuer so you never miss out on those extra points or cashback opportunities.

Keep an Eye on Sign-Up Bonuses and Promotional Offers

A well-timed sign-up bonus can give your rewards balance a serious boost. Many cards offer substantial bonus points or cashback after you spend a certain amount within the first few months. Don’t shy away from these offers—just be sure to factor in your overall spending habits so you don’t overspend in pursuit of rewards.

Utilize Digital Tools

The future of rewards is digital—and so is the way you manage them. Take full advantage of your card’s mobile app to track rewards, monitor spending, and receive personalized offers. Some apps even offer AI-driven insights that suggest ways to optimize spending based on your habits. With the right tools, managing your rewards becomes a seamless part of your daily routine.

Stack Rewards When Possible

Stacking isn’t just for pancake lovers. Look for opportunities to combine rewards from your credit card with other loyalty programs. For example, some cards allow you to transfer points to airline miles or hotel loyalty programs, giving you extra value and flexibility. A little research can often reveal hidden gem promotions where stacking rewards multiplies your benefits.

By using these strategies, you not only maximize the return on every dollar spent but also transform routine transactions into a strategic path towards achieving your financial goals—be it a summer vacation abroad or an emergency fund boost.

Key Considerations When Choosing a Rewards Credit Card in 2025

With so many options on the market, knowing what to look for is critical when selecting a rewards card that’s right for you. Here are some key factors to weigh:

Annual Fees and Interest Rates

While many cards offer enticing rewards, they often come at a cost. Assess the annual fee relative to the rewards you expect to earn. Additionally, consider the interest rate—if you’re the type to carry a balance, a high APR can quickly offset your rewards benefits.

Redemption Flexibility and Value

Not all rewards are created equal. Some cards might boast a high points rate, but if redeeming those points is convoluted or devalues them, you might end up with less bang for your buck. Look for cards that offer straight-up, flexible redemption options, whether it’s for travel, cashback, or even gift cards.

Sign-Up Bonuses and Introductory Offers

A robust sign-up bonus can be a powerful head start in earning rewards. Evaluate the spending requirements, time limits, and overall value of any sign-up offer. Sometimes a card with a slightly lower ongoing rewards rate might provide a better overall value if its introductory bonus is more generous.

User Experience and Digital Tools

In a world where convenience is king, the quality of a credit card’s app and online account management tools can make all the difference. Look for user-friendly interfaces, mobile wallet compatibility, and AI-driven insight features that help you optimize your spending and monitor rewards in real time.

Customer Service and Support

Last but not least, consider the level of customer support offered. Whether it’s round-the-clock assistance, specialized travel support, or responsive online chat services, a great customer experience can help you navigate any issues that arise.

Frequently Asked Questions About the Best Credit Cards For Rewards 2025

Your questions are our command—right here are some of the most frequently asked questions about the best rewards credit cards in 2025.

1. What’s the main difference between cashback, points, and miles credit cards?

Cashback cards return a percentage of your spending as cash, points cards allow flexible redemption for travel, merchandise, or cashback, and miles cards focus on earning frequent flyer miles for travel-related perks.

2. How do I choose the right credit card for my spending habits?

Start by reviewing your monthly spending categories and priorities. If you spend a lot on dining and groceries, a cashback card might be best, whereas if you travel frequently, look for a miles card with travel perks. Be sure to compare annual fees, interest rates, and the rewards structure before making a decision.

3. Are sign-up bonuses worth it, and how can I maximize them?

Absolutely—the right sign-up bonus can give you a huge head start in earning rewards. Make sure you can meet the minimum spending requirement without overspending, and plan your major purchases around the bonus period.

4. Can I combine rewards from multiple cards?

While you can use multiple cards to optimize rewards based on purchase categories, most programs do not allow direct combining of rewards points across different cards. However, some issuers offer transfer options between their own reward programs.

5. How secure are modern rewards credit cards?

Credit card issuers employ advanced security measures such as biometric authentication, real-time fraud alerts, and encrypted transaction technologies, ensuring your rewards and personal information remain secure.

6. What if I don’t pay my balance in full every month?

Carrying a balance can negate the benefits of earning rewards due to high interest rates. It’s always best to pay in full each month to truly take advantage of the perks offered.

7. Are there any rewards cards specifically designed for young professionals?

Yes! Many issuers now offer rewards cards with benefits tailored for millennials and Gen Z, featuring low annual fees, flexible redemption options, and integration with digital tools that simplify budgeting and spending analysis.

8. How often do bonus categories change on rewards cards?

Bonus categories typically rotate quarterly or annually, but it varies by card. Staying updated via your card’s mobile app or email alerts can help you plan accordingly.
